Hi, I’m using Prime Go and Engine Lightning. With the 4.1 update it seems like the layout was changed for the Lightning view: There’s not anymore a complete waveform preview at the bottom e.g. in the “Overrides” screen, but only a small play position indication and basic information for both tracks.
It has now become quite cumbersome to activate Lightning overrides at the right moment in a track. Despite all the great updates, this is quite a drawback to the previous versions.
Did I miss something and you can bring back the full track waveform via an option?
At least I didn’t find it. Or maybe in an update you could bring it back?
